When this socket is used with a husk 13 as shown in Fig. 6, so that the thumb cannot be used, the same disen agement of the shell margin from the cap ange may be effected by in serting between them some thin object such as a knife or screw-driver. This means for securing the shell to the cap is also neat and inconspicuous.
To adapt the interior parts of the socket to this particular construction of inclosing case, the upper part of the insulating base should be made of a smaller diameter than the lower. As here shown the base is composed of the porcelain blocks 15 and 16 of which the upper is slight-ly less in diameter than the lower. The reason is to afford a little space for the passage of the lug 9 and also space to permit the pressing in of the upper margin of the shell, when it is to be d1sengaged from the cap; furthermore it' the two blocks were made of the same diameter tas common heretofore) there might be cases,
where, owing to unavoidable accidental irregularities, ythe upper block would overhang the lower at some point, making ditiicult the placing of the shell in position.
The insulating lining 18 is positively securedin the shell and disarrangement there ot avoided by lugs 1t) 19 on each side ot` the thumb-piece slot turned in to engage with the lining. (lorres )ending notches to receive these lugs may be ormed in the lining. The formation ot' the guide grooves 8 by forcing in the inetal at the upper margin of the shell also cooperates to retain the insulating lining in position.
A simple and economical construction of fiber lining for the cap is shown. This consists of a ring of fiber 21, split at one point from the cord hole, forming a spiral with overlapping ends. The cap is formed with a plurality of small projections 22. rl`he spiral ring is easily compressed to be inserted behind these projections, and. then expanding, is securely retained in place.
26 is the outer lamp terminal surrounded by the insulating bushing Q7. I
In Fig. 2 is shown one ot the two wire terminals 28, to which the wires are led through the grooves 29 2th The switch and the other metallic parts coni'iecting the respective terminals are arranged between the porcelain blocks.
In all the other figures the slots T are shown arranged in a circun'ifercntial line, and the lips similarly :ii-ranged and on the edge of the cap flange; but in Fig. t), the
li )s 6 are formed on the flange above its e ge, and inclined as shown; the slots T are similarly inclined. This slightly modified construction is sometimes desirable, as I it permits the disengagement of the shell from the cap to be made more easily.
The reason for the inclination of the two slots, remote from the thuinbpiece slot 10, and of the corresponding two lips` is that, in 'compressing the uppcr margin ot the shell to separate the parts, the two sides of the thumb-piece slot are forcedtoward each other and it is natural to roclr the shell in that direction, z'. c. toward the thumb piece slot, first to `withdraw the lipsI o ti, on the opposite side from the slots i" T' (instead of compressing the margin to a greater extent andV pulling the shell straight out).
lllhen the shell is so rocked, it will be evident that, it' inclined as shown, the lips G (3 will more easily disengage from their slots.
